Firozpur: Punjab Police got big success, recovered 13 kg heroin and 5 AK-47s, 5 pistols
The Punjab Police is constantly taking action to rein in criminals. In this episode, Punjab Police has achieved great success in the joint operation with BSF.
In this joint operation, 13 kg heroin, 5 AK-47s, 5 pistols, and 9 magazines have been recovered from the Ferozepur district. The DGP of Punjab Police has given information.
He said that a consignment of arms was recovered from the field of a farmer of Vahka village in the Sadar area near Border Out Post (BOP) Dona Telu Mal.
According to officials, these weapons were buried in the soil.
A few days ago, while giving information on Sunday, the Punjab Police said that they have arrested a person and seized eight Chinese pistols, 60 bullets, and two kilograms of heroin, which was smuggled into India through a drone from Pakistan.
A police officer had given this information.
A Punjab Police official had said that the accused has been identified as Paramjeet Singh, a resident of Havalian village in Tarn Taran district.
The consignment will be smuggled. Police said the drone dropped the consignment inside Indian territory on Friday and Paramjit Singh recovered it on Saturday.
A few days ago, the Punjab Police arrested two smugglers with 13 kg of heroin. The accused were arrested from Rajasthan. These accused were adopting Jammu and Kashmir network.
Punjab’s DGP Gaurav Yadav had given the information. He had said that the police has started looking for the network of the accused.

Breaking News: Punjab Police gets big success. Four henchmen of Lawrence Bishnoi gang were arrested, and three pistols and 22 live cartridges were also recovered.
Punjab’s Ropar district police arrested four operatives of the Lawrence Bishnoi gang on Monday. While one of his companions managed to escape.
Police have recovered three pistols, one magazine, and 22 live cartridges from them.
SSP Vivek S Soni said that SP (Detective) Manvinder Singh, DSP (Detective) Talwinder Singh Gill, CIA Inspector Satnam Singh along with their team arrested the four gangsters.
They have been identified as Kuldeep Singh, Kulwinder Singh Tinka, Satveer Singh Shammi, and Beant Singh.
